What Is a Slip and Fall Accident?
A slip and fall accident occurs when someone is injured because of a hazardous condition on another person's property. These cases are generally handled under premises liability law.
Property owners, business operators, landlords, and other responsible parties may be liable if they fail to maintain reasonably safe conditions for lawful visitors.
Common Causes of Slip and Fall Accidents
Slip and fall accidents can occur almost anywhere, including stores, restaurants, apartment buildings, parking lots, office buildings, and private homes.
Common hazards include:
- Wet or slippery floors
- Uneven sidewalks
- Broken stairs
- Loose carpeting
- Poor lighting
- Ice and snow accumulation
- Potholes
- Damaged flooring
- Missing handrails
- Cluttered walkways
Many of these accidents are preventable with proper maintenance and timely repairs.

Proving Liability in a Slip and Fall Case
To recover compensation, it is generally necessary to establish that the property owner or another responsible party acted negligently.
A successful claim often requires showing:
- A dangerous condition existed.
- The property owner knew or should have known about the hazard.
- The hazard was not repaired or adequately addressed.
- The dangerous condition caused your injuries.
- You suffered measurable damages.
Evidence collected shortly after the accident can play an important role in proving liability.

Dealing With Insurance Companies
Insurance companies frequently attempt to reduce or deny premises liability claims.
They may argue that:
- The hazard was obvious.
- You were distracted.
- The property owner lacked notice of the dangerous condition.
- Your injuries are less serious than claimed.
A skilled attorney understands these tactics and works to protect your interests during settlement negotiations.
What to Do After a Slip and Fall Accident
The actions you take immediately after an accident can affect your ability to recover compensation.
You should:
- Seek medical attention immediately.
- Report the accident to the property owner or manager.
- Photograph the hazardous condition before it is repaired, if possible.
- Gather witness contact information.
- Preserve your shoes and clothing if relevant.
- Keep copies of all medical records and bills.
- Avoid discussing your case on social media.
- Contact a slip and fall attorney as soon as possible.
Taking these steps helps preserve valuable evidence while protecting your legal rights.
